5.72 Address Duplication, Poor Setting
Applicable
Models
Centralized controller
intelligent Touch Controller
Schedule timer
Error Code MC
Method of Error
Detection
DIII-NET communication data is used to detect the error.
Error Decision
Conditions
Multiple centralized controllers or intelligent touch controllers are connected, and the controllers
are both set as main centralized controllers or sub centralized controllers.
Two schedule timers are connected.
Supposed
Causes
Centralized controller address duplication
